Macedonia's Greens See Red Over Deadly Smog

A coalition of 21 environmentalist groups and NGOs from across Macedonia is considering more protest marches as well as possible blockades of institutions and streets during February.

They accuse the authorities of failing to take relevant action against extremely high levels of air pollution in the capital and in several other towns.

At least five dead in storm and flood in Macedonian town

At least five persons, among them four children, died on Monday during a strong storm in the area of the town of Tetovo in southwestern Macedonia.

Macedonian MIA agency said that a ten-year-old child had died in the flooding, while the lifeless body of a 13-year-old girl "most likely from the village of Shipkovac" was brought to the hospital in Tetovo.

Serbian Leader Plans Historic Visit to Albania

Serbia's Prime Minister says he intends to visit Albania to improve regional relations, frayed by the recent violence in Kumanovo, Macedonia.

"For each of our countries it is important to invest in peace and stability in the region, so that what happened in Kumanovo does not happen again," Vucic said in Sarajevo, where he is participating in a business forum.

Albanian prime minister cancels visit to Macedonia

TIRANA, BERLIN -- Albanian Prime Minister Edi Rama has canceled his official visit to Macedonia, planned for May 14, Albanian language media in Pristina are reporting.

Rama was to visit Skopje and Tetovo, the website Albeu said on Tuesday, quoting sources from the Albanian Foreign Ministry.

Child injured in explosion near Albanian party HQ

TETOVO -- An explosive device activated near the local headquarters of the Albanian Democratic Union for Integration (DUI) in Mala Recica near Tetovo has injured a child.

The DUI, led by Ali Ahmeti, is together with the VMRO DPMNE in power in Macedonia on the state level.
